Description
Set in a future where interstellar travel is the norm, a powerful corporation known as the Zarathustra Company believes itself to wield absolute control over the cosmos. Tasked with a mission to explore and exploit uncharted territories, they also face the unexpected challenges that come with navigating the unknown. As tensions rise and corporate interests clash, the crew finds themselves grappling with both external threats and internal strife, leading to questions about loyalty and morality.
Amidst this backdrop of adventure and corporate intrigue, the narrative delves into the consequences of unbridled ambition. Personal stories intertwine with grand cosmic events, revealing the fragility of human connections in a world dominated by profit. The interactions between characters explore themes of trust, betrayal, and the relentless pursuit of power, painting a vivid picture of life in a universe where the stakes are higher than ever imagined.
